Richard Bacon Maternity Unit Special
We hear from the nurses, midwives, mothers and fathers at the Leicester Royal Infirmary.
The staff at the Leicester Royal Infirmary's maternity unit deliver nearly 6000 babies every year. Today Richard gets a behind the scenes look at how it works, speaks to new and expectant mothers and fathers about their hopes and fears, and speaks to the men and women who are responsible for bringing the newborns into the world.
